A.2.7 Reed-Solomon Coder/Decoder
The Reed-Solomon coder receives scrambled data packets in byte serial format.
RS(204,188,8) shortened code—from the original RS(255,239,8) code—is applied to
each scrambled transport packet (188 bytes) to generate an error-protected packet. Refer
to Figure A-17 for the packet arrangement.
Note: RS coding is also applied to the non-inverted or inverted packet sync byte.
The shortened Reed-Solomon code is implemented by adding 51 bytes, all set to zero, to
the information bytes at the input of a (255,239) encoder. These bytes are discarded after
the encoding procedure.
The code and field generator polynomials are shown below.
Code Generator Polynomial:

Field Generator Polynomial:
p(x) = x8 + x4 + x3 + x2 + 1
